Two Bo'ness GP surgeries set to merge together as one practice

A new medical practice serving the communities of Bo’ness and Blackness is to be formed by merging the existing Forth View GP and Kinglass Medical Practice.

The new GP surgery, which will be known as Kinneil Medical Practice, will launch in October, operating out of the two existing premises.

Registered patients have begun to receive letters informing of the upcoming merger – with no action required to merge records or move their registration over.

The practice team are working with NHS Forth Valley and Falkirk Health and Social Care Partnership to ensure a smooth and successful transition period, with minimal

disruption to care delivery or patients.
